Transaction e5e51750774eb30b8401341c323a18780132e91e2f28d2b958f6b3da8e8b3f37

1 Input
2 Outputs
  • e5e51750774eb30b8401341c323a18780132e91e2f28d2b958f6b3da8e8b3f37:0
  • value  1443000
    address  33FxpwPs9edkeKLfeaqKfkQUy4DWNneJwX
  • e5e51750774eb30b8401341c323a18780132e91e2f28d2b958f6b3da8e8b3f37:1
  • value  117619
    address  1N9GvyYmLW3KTMVBz57kSyo2r3n6tLkdHY